Webb28 mars 2024 · Start up in Recovery mode by holding Command-R. Once in Recovery mode, open Terminal from the Utilities menu. There type repairHomePermissions and press Return. That should launch the Repair Home app. Select the correct user account from those offered, and enter the admin password for that account. Internet recovery after selecting command r means no recovery partition found. how to increase club speed in golfWebbShut down your Mac. Hold down Command-Option/Alt-R and press the Power button. Hold down those keys until you a spinning globe and the message “Starting Internet Recovery.
